T78 Questions
Can you run the set up without a ported motor, and please list everything that you would need to run the setup. I allready have the T78 kit. O ya it's for a FD. Can you run it with PMS. I need to know about fuel, what size injecters, and so on. Thank you for any help.

You can put it on a motor that isn't ported, but you may not have the top end power that a ported motor would have. That turbo has ALOT of good top end power.
I believe that Jason was running a PMS with his T-78. You'll need 1200 cc secondaries, but that may not be enough if you plan on alot of boost. If you ran the 850's as primaries as well that should help, but I don't know much about the PMS and if it can handle that.
You'll just need the usual mods: Fuel pump and injectors, full exhaust, front mount intercooler, etc.
